Presynaptic inhibition: primary afferent depolarization in crayfish neurons
Authors:D Kennedy  R L Calabrese  J J Wine
Abstract:Inhibition of transmission between tactile sensory neurons and interneurons in the crayfish was investigated by intracellular recording int the presynaptic processes. Inhibition is correlated with a depolarization of the presynaptic process, as in the mammalian spinal cord; the depolarization is accompanied by a conductance increase, and is mediated by interneurons that can be excited by a variety of routes.
